Brauerei Fischer
|
Map |
| Small Brewery (less than 1000 hl/yr) |
| Haus Nr. 2 |
Phone: 09547/488
|
| 96179 Freudeneck |
| For over 100 years |
Lager (draft only)
|
|
|
|
Closed: Monday
